Matra

noun

noun ·2 syllables ·Rare ·Advanced level

Definitions

Noun
  1. 1
    In Indian music, the smallest rhythmic unit of a tala.
  2. 2
    In Indian poetics and linguistics, a measure of the length of a syllable; equivalent to mora.
  3. 3
    The characteristic horizontal line drawn above characters in some Indic scripts.
  4. 4
    An intra-syllabic vowel symbol in Indic scripts.

Etymology

Borrowed from Sanskrit मात्रा (mātrā, “measure, small quantity”).
